SRES 314 · 119th Congress · SenateOther

A resolution recognizing the importance of trademarks in the economy and the role of trademarks in protecting consumer safety, by designating the month of July as "National Anti-Counterfeiting and Consumer Education and Awareness Month".

In plain language: This resolution designates July 2025 as National Anti-Counterfeiting and Consumer Education and Awareness Month.

Timeline

How it moved.

  1. Jul 17, 2025Resolution agreed to in Senate without amendment and with a preamble by Unanimous Consent. (consideration: CR S4490; text: 07/08/2025 CR S4259)
  2. Jul 17, 2025Passed/agreed to in Senate: Resolution agreed to in Senate without amendment and with a preamble by Unanimous Consent.
  3. Jul 8, 2025Introduced in Senate
